Ceramic vs. Porcelain Tiles

The most popular tile materials in bathrooms are ceramic and porcelain. While they are similar, each has unique traits. Knowing the difference is essential when determining what kind of tile is best for a bathroom floor.

During production, ceramic tiles are fired at lower temperatures, making them less dense and more absorbent. These moisture-absorbent properties can be beneficial for bathrooms.

In contrast, porcelain tiles are fired at higher temperatures, resulting in dense, less porous tiles. This density makes them ideal for moist environments, providing durability and water resistance.

Terrific Options: Natural Stone Tiles

Natural stone tiles are a tremendous choice for those seeking an organic look. Options include marble, granite, limestone, and travertine, each adding a unique texture and color to your floor.

Benefits of Natural Stone

Natural stone tiles come in a spectrum of colors and patterns, providing character to any bathroom. They are durable, timeless, and elevate the elegance of your space.

Although beautiful, stone tiles are porous and typically require sealing to protect them from water and stains. Regular maintenance is essential but well worth the luxury they provide.

Maintenance Needs

Understanding the upkeep involved is vital when choosing tiles. Some materials may require more care than others for longevity and cleanliness.

Cleaning Tips

Ceramic and porcelain tiles require routine cleaning with mild detergents, while natural stones need special cleaners and regular sealing to maintain their appearance.

FAQs

Q: What is the most durable bathroom tile?

A: Porcelain tiles are considered the most durable, highly resistant to water and wear, making them an ideal choice for bathroom floors.

Q: Are natural stone tiles a good choice for bathrooms?

A: Yes, natural stone tiles add sophistication and charm, but require particular maintenance and should be sealed to protect them from moisture.

Q: How do I ensure my tiles are safe?

A: Use non-slip tiles or apply a non-slip coating to safeguard the bathroom floors, especially in wet conditions.
